@@ -1,10 +1,14 @@
+- 0.5.5.0 :
+    * Made HeaderEditor a Monoid instance
+    * Trying to WINDOW_UPDATE an unexistent stream aborts the session, as it should
+
 - 0.5.4.0 :
     * Added the type HTTP500PrecursorException and corresponding test
     * Improved test suite so that requests can be simulated a little bit more easily
     * Re-export type Headers from module HTTPHeaders
 
-- 0.5.3.2 : 
-    * Added this changelog. 
+- 0.5.3.2 :
+    * Added this changelog.
     * Fixed the lower limit for the time package.
     * Enforce first frame being a settings frame when receiving.
     * Added a couple of tests.
